Quote:
Originally Posted by TROLLEY View Post
Who are the "other guys" with MY11 STi's who had 239hp before even doing anything? Did they do a dyno run before the modifications to see what they were putting out stock? I doubt it. Sounds to me you've got factory figures in mind which are actually flywheel numbers, not at the hubs.

Also, some cars are just spuds. I can attest to that with my '08. Other owners with 08's with the same mods as me were getting 10-20hp more than my car on the same dyno, by the same tuner. Some were running 18/19psi but the maximum boost my car would safely take was 16.7psi. Not every car is the same nor will react the same as others after modifications and tune.

You might just be driving a potato unfortunately.
